Output 12bbaa2c5215c6e39ff5ac9f976ab34639149e51c14a21df52b664bc6d59099b:1

value
1515588
script pubkey
OP_0 OP_PUSHBYTES_20 94efec55482818fb245f4e77102d88a51893b74e
address
bc1qjnh7c42g9qv0kfzlfem3qtvg55vf8d6w5a007g
transaction
12bbaa2c5215c6e39ff5ac9f976ab34639149e51c14a21df52b664bc6d59099b
spent
true